  2. Professional Photographers of America -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Professional_Photographers...

    PAA offered the Directory of Professional Photography, which first appeared in 1938, and the degree program, which awarded its first Master of Photography degree in 1939. [citation needed] The organization changed its name to Professional Photographers of America, Inc. in 1958 to distinguish the association from amateur photography organizations.

  6. Frank J. Schlueter -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Frank_J._Schlueter

    Schlueter photographed the quickly growing Houston region in the first half of the twentieth century, retiring in 1964. [1] Schlueter's work was used by early oil producers in the region to document and promote their work.

  9. Fox Photo -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fox_Photo

    Fox Photo Inc. was an American chain of photo stores, which sold cameras, photographic equipment and developed film. The Fox company started as a small photo studio by a man named Arthur C. Fox in San Antonio, Texas.
